Keep complete and accurate records of the finances in your business. You need good financial records at tax time, of course, but you especially need well-organized records in case you are surprised by an IRS audit. These records can also give you a clear glimpse of how you are doing month to month.

Follow workplace safety requirements for your home office. Smoke detectors and fire extinguishers are a must. Also, make sure that your computer configuration suits your style. Installing fire safety items can help lower insurance premiums, and a safe, ergonomic computer desk and accessories reduce the risk of carpal tunnel injuries.

If your business requires you to make your product, figure out what the cost is to make each product. Basically, wholesale markup is two times your cost. Retail mark-up is twice that of the wholesale price. Price your items at a rate that works for your customers and yourself.

There are rules and regulations governing what kind of business you can have from home. While office workers can usually have at-home offices, if you are running a business that sells products or receives customers, you are likely going to face governmental hurdles to running the business from home. This information is readily available from governmental bodies in any region. There may also be additional rules for your neighborhood that are part of your homeowners’ association’s rules.
